Group 1: ClearBridge Investments and Mid Cap Strategy - ClearBridge Mid Cap Strategy underperformed against the Russell Midcap Index, which returned 0.16% during Q4 2025, due to narrow market leadership and sentiment-driven trading [1] - Weakness in information technology and real estate holdings negatively impacted returns, while gains in select consumer discretionary stocks provided partial support [1] - The portfolio management team expressed cautious optimism for the future, citing improving clarity around policy, interest rates, and business investment as potential positive factors for active stock selection [1] Group 2: Churchill Downs Inc. Overview - Churchill Downs Inc. operates gaming, racing, and online wagering assets, including the Kentucky Derby, with a one-month return of -11.91% and a market capitalization of approximately $7.029 billion [2] - The stock price of Churchill Downs Inc. has fluctuated between $85.58 and $126.60 over the past 52 weeks, closing at around $100.23 on January 27, 2026 [2] Group 3: Performance Insights on Churchill Downs Inc. - ClearBridge Investments highlighted Churchill Downs Inc. as a new holding that advanced as operating trends normalized following earlier weaknesses related to the Kentucky Derby and softer consumer sentiment [3] - Churchill Downs Inc. was held by 45 hedge fund portfolios at the end of Q3, an increase from 43 in the previous quarter, indicating growing interest among institutional investors [4]
